When I was a young kid in the mid 1970's, I remember my dad INSISTED that we get this new thing called "Cable TV" installed in our house. Sure, we had to now "pay" a monthly bill for television programming but we had far more channels to choose from (26 cable channels, instead of only 5 network TV channels) but the BEST PART was there would be absolutely NO TV COMMERCIALS with this new cable TV service. That was the major selling point! My dad hated TV commercials more than anything else in the world. lol. If you "pay" for TV, then there will not be ANY TV commercials. The networks would just get their money from cable TV subscribers instead of selling TV commercials. It was AWESOME! I remember watching the original movie "JAWS" over and over again with zero commercial breaks....
Somewhere along the way cable TV companies started selling commercials WHILE still collecting their monthly service fees from all of their cable TV subscribers. And somehow everyone just sat by and watched themselves get screwed over by the cable TV companies. Nowadays, we obviously have far more commercials than we have ever had in the past during any given TV show AND the price of cable TV (or satellite TV) is through the roof, and the rates are only going up...... which is crazy to me in these modern times. Considering the cable and satellite companies are no longer the only way for people to get programming into their homes, yet they price their service as if their customers have no choice but to pay their ransom. lolol.
The reason for this long winded post.... I just hope YouTube doesn't go down the same path that the early cable TV companies went down. I hope they don't charge for YT Premium service and then someday start running commercials for paying customers. It sounds ridiculous right?..... Well, I've seen it happen before.
